Abstract
The utility model discloses a male urine sampler, which comprises a storage cylinder for storing urine samples, wherein one end of the storage cylinder is connected with an input pipe, the input pipe is connected with a trumpet-shaped urine receiving hopper, and the other end of the storage cylinder is connected with an output pipe; the valve rod is provided with a section of reduced journal portion, the valve rod penetrates through the input pipe and the output pipe in a pressing contact mode, the journal portion intersects with pipe holes of the input pipe and the output pipe when the valve rod slides to the limit in the axial direction towards one end, the pipe holes of the input pipe and the output pipe are opened, and the valve rod is completely staggered with the pipe holes of the input pipe and the output pipe when the valve rod slides to the limit in the axial direction towards the other end, so that the pipe holes of the input pipe and the output pipe are plugged. This urine sampler, simple structure, easy to use can accurately realize middle section urine and take, is difficult for splashing on hand, convenient to use.

Background
Urine testing is a routine test in which the test subject is typically required to leave clean mid-stream urine for a given test, i.e., during a urination, urine from the leading and trailing ends is not required, but only urine from an intermediate period of urination. At present, when urine is taken, a larger measuring cup is usually adopted for taking the urine, and after the urine is taken, the urine is poured into a test tube with a specific volume from the measuring cup, so that the collection of a urine sample is completed. However, in the actual sampling process, for example, in the case of men, it is difficult for the examinee to sample the urine in a standard manner, that is, to take out a part of the urine first, then to put the measuring cup on the urine column during urination, to stop the flow of urine, so that the urine is likely to hit the measuring cup and splash, and the smaller-caliber measuring cup is likely to splash, so that the urine is likely to be received, and the larger-caliber measuring cup is uneconomical, so that the measuring cup is not wasted, the cleaning workload of the measuring cup is not increased, and in the primary urination process, the examinee is difficult to interrupt urination deliberately and put the measuring cup in a position in advance, so that the simple and rough urine taking mode is very inconvenient at present.

Detailed Description
The following description of the embodiments of the present utility model will be made clearly and completely with reference to the accompanying drawings, in which it is apparent that the embodiments described are only some embodiments of the present utility model, but not all embodiments. All other embodiments, which can be made by those skilled in the art based on the embodiments of the utility model without making any inventive effort, are intended to be within the scope of the utility model.
As an implementation structure of the present utility model, a male urine sampler, as shown in fig. 1, mainly includes a storage cylinder for storing urine samples, and the storage cylinder may be cylindrical 6-shaped or other possible shapes. In particular, one end of the storage cylinder is connected with the input pipe 2, and the input pipe 2 is connected with the trumpet-shaped urine receiving hopper 8, so that urine can flow into the input pipe 2 from the trumpet-shaped urine receiving hopper 8 more easily, and then flow into the storage cylinder more easily. Meanwhile, the other end of the storage cylinder is also connected with an output pipe 3 so as to discharge urine in the storage cylinder. One of the more critical structures is that in this embodiment, a valve rod 4 is inserted into each of the input pipe 2 and the output pipe 3 in a sliding fit manner, and this valve rod 4 has a reduced journal portion, for example, the middle section of the valve rod 4 is much smaller than the rest of the rod sections, so as to form a neck structure, and the valve rod 4 penetrates through the input pipe 2 or the output pipe 3 in a pressing contact manner, preferably directly penetrates in the radial direction, but maintains a dynamic seal fit structure at the penetrated position. This valve stem 4 also needs to meet the condition that, when the valve stem 4 is slid toward one end thereof to the limit position in the axial direction, as shown in fig. 1, the journal portion intersects the orifice of the input tube 2 so that the orifice of the input tube 2 is opened when the valve stem 4 is slid toward the right to the limit as shown in fig. 1. For the output tube 3, when the valve rod 4 slides to the limit in the axial direction towards the other end, i.e. towards the left end, the shaft neck is completely staggered with the tube hole of the output tube 3, so that the two valve rods 4 can be positioned to enable the input tube 2 to be opened, the tube hole of the output tube 3 to be blocked, and urine can flow into the storage tube at the moment and then exist in the storage tube.
When sampling, the testee holds the urine sampler, firstly, push the two valve rods 4 to the right to the limit position, so that the input tube 2 and the output tube 3 are opened, after the patient urinates, urine flows out through the urine receiving hopper 8, the input tube 2, the storage tube and the output tube 3, after a while urinating, the testee pushes the valve rod 4 on the output tube 3 to the left to the limit, the output tube 3 is sealed, urine flows into and stores in the storage tube at the moment, when the urine in the storage tube reaches the required amount, the valve rod 4 on the input tube 2 is pushed to the right to the limit again, the input tube 2 is sealed, at the moment, the urine stays in the urine receiving hopper 8, the patient can select to remove the urine sampler in time, after the urine is continuously urinated to the end, the urine in the urine receiving hopper 8 is poured out, then pushes the valve rod 4 to the limit to the right, the middle section urine collected in the storage tube is poured into a specific test tube through the urine receiving hopper 8 for use.
As a specific implementation detail, with continued reference to fig. 1, a nut-shaped pressing cap 5 is fixed to each of two ends of the valve rod 4, the pressing caps 5 are coaxially disposed with the valve rod 4, and the diameter of the pressing cap 5 is larger than that of the valve rod 4, so as to push the valve rod 4 to the limit position. In a specific manufacturing process, as shown in fig. 3-4, regarding the structure of the valve rod 4, one end of each of the two pressing caps 5 opposite to each other is coaxially and fixedly connected with a valve column 401, the two valve columns 401 are connected through a connecting rod 7 coaxially arranged with the two valve columns, and the diameter of the connecting rod 7 is smaller than that of the valve column 401, so that the connecting part between the connecting rod 7 and the two valve columns 401 forms a journal.
In addition, in this embodiment, with continued reference to fig. 1, in order to better slidably mount the valve rod 4, a section of cylinder 6 perpendicular to the input pipe 2 and the output pipe 3 may be provided on both the input pipe and the output pipe, specifically, in the injection molding process, a certain hardness may be maintained after the integral molding, and the valve column 401 may coaxially pass through a central hole reserved in the cylinder 6, and pass through a plurality of sealing rings embedded on an inner wall of the central hole in a pressing fit manner, so as to realize sliding sealing.
Of course, the part of the input pipe 2 or the output pipe 3 through which the valve rod 4 slides may be made of elastic rubber, that is, the part has quite elasticity after molding, and sealing can be realized by means of self elastic extrusion contact, so that the valve rod 4 and the rubber can be always in extrusion contact with dynamic sealing fit without additionally arranging the sealing ring.
To facilitate pouring of collected urine, as shown in fig. 1-2, a side wall of the urinal bucket 8 is protruded to the outside, and a urination groove 10 is formed in the inner surface of the side wall in the direction of the bus line thereof. The cross section of the urination groove 10 is recommended to adopt an isosceles triangle, and the vertex formed by the intersection of two waists of the isosceles triangle falls at the bottom end of the urination groove 10, and the cross section of the urination groove 10 gradually increases from the small end to the large end of the urine receiving hopper 8 so as to pour out urine rapidly and thoroughly. Of course, the small end of the urine discharge tank 10 is directly connected with the inlet end of the input pipe 2, so that the discharge efficiency of the urine sample in the storage tube can be improved.
Although the horn-shaped urine receiving hopper 8 is adopted in the embodiment, the upper end of the urine receiving hopper is larger than the lower end of the urine receiving hopper, in order to more thoroughly avoid urine from splashing on hands, as shown in fig. 1-2, a skirt-shaped shielding film 9 is fixedly surrounded at a large port of the urine receiving hopper 8, and the shielding film 9 can cover the hands of a person when the urine receiving hopper 8 is held by the hands of the person; in particular, the shielding film 9 may be a thin plastic film or a plastic skin which is in a skirt fold shape, so that the shielding film 9 has certain rigidity and shape stability. Finally, as a further implementation detail, the above shielding film 9 is fixedly tied to the urine receiving funnel 8 at a distance of 1-3cm from its large end opening, in order that the mouth of a particular test tube may rest against the mouth edge of the urine receiving funnel 8 above the shielding film 9 when urine samples are discharged from the urine receiving funnel 8, for example against the slot end opening of the urine discharge slot 10 above the shielding film 9, so that urine does not flow onto the hand along the outer wall of the urine receiving funnel 8 when pouring.
